+		// Check whether all ways have identical relationship membership. More 
+		// specifically: If one of the selected ways is a member of relation X
+		// in role Y, then all selected ways must be members of X in role Y.
+		
+		// FIXME: In a later revision, we should display some sort of conflict 
+		// dialog like we do for tags, to let the user choose which relations
+		// should be kept.
+		
+		// Step 1, iterate over all relations and create counters indicating
+		// how many of the selected ways are part of relation X in role Y
+		// (hashMap backlinks contains keys formed like X@Y)
+		HashMap<String, Integer> backlinks = new HashMap<String, Integer>();
+		HashSet<Relation> relationsUsingWays = new HashSet<Relation>();
+		for (Relation r : Main.ds.relations) {
+			if (r.deleted) continue;
+			for (RelationMember rm : r.members) {
+				if (rm.member instanceof Way) {
+					for(Way w : selectedWays) {
+						if (rm.member == w) {
+							String hash = Long.toString(r.id) + "@" + rm.role;
+							System.out.println(hash);
+							if (backlinks.containsKey(hash)) {
+								backlinks.put(hash, new Integer(backlinks.get(hash)+1));
+							} else {
+								backlinks.put(hash, 1);
+							}
+							// this is just a cache for later use
+							relationsUsingWays.add(r);
+						}
+					}
+				}
+			}
+		}
+		
+		// Step 2, all values of the backlinks HashMap must now equal the size
+		// of the selection.
+		for (Integer i : backlinks.values()) {
+			if (i.intValue() != selectedWays.size()) {
+				JOptionPane.showMessageDialog(Main.parent, tr("The selected ways cannot be combined as they have differing relation memberships."));
+				return;				
+			}
 		}
